The association between social support and cognitive function in Mexican adults aged 50 and older

TL;DR: While social support helped to improve cognitive function in older adults aged 71-80, this same association was not observed in adults of other ages, suggesting there could be a window of opportunity to improve Cognitive functioning for this group.

Incidence of type 2 diabetes in Mexico: Results of The Mexico City Diabetes Study after 18 years of follow-up

TL;DR: This is the first estimate of long-term incidence of type 2 diabetes in Mexican population, and the incidence is among the highest reported worldwide.

Musculoskeletal disorders and occupational demands in nurses at a tertiary care hospital in Mexico City

TL;DR: Postural demands are closely associated with the development of musculoskeletal disorders and early identification and timely intervention are fundamental.
